Web14. okt 2024 · Milk is a good temporary preservative because it has a chemical makeup compatible with teeth. It does not matter if it is whole milk, two percent, one percent, or skim milk. Milk contains several substances including antibacterial agents, proteins, and sugars that cells on the root need to survive. It also helps maintain the right balance of acids. WebRinse your tooth with water or milk to remove any dirt. Avoid using soap, and do not scrub or dry the tooth. Gently place your tooth back into the socket, root first. Hold your tooth by the crown and avoid touching the root. Bite on a napkin, gauze or handkerchief to anchor your tooth in place. Visit a dentist immediately. field tickets
